aggregateroute#
Collection Note
This module is part of the nokia.eda_protocols_v1 collection. To install the collection, use:
Added in version1.0.0. Synopsis#
- The AggregateRoute enables the configuration of aggregated routes on a specified Router. This resource allows for the definition of destination prefixes, the selection of a router, and optionally, specific nodes where the aggregate routes should be configured. Advanced options include the ability to generate ICMP unreachable messages for packets matching the aggregate route, and the ability to block the advertisement of all contributing routes in dynamic protocols like BGP.
Parameters#
| Parameter | Defaults / Choices | Comments |
|---|---|---|
| authToken str required | HTTP authentication (Bearer authentication) string in the format of "Bearer TOKEN". Required unless state is cronly. | |
| baseUrl str required | EDA API URL including the schema and port (if non standard for the provided schema). Example - https://try.eda.demo:9443. Required unless state is cronly. | |
| caPath str required | A path to the PEM-encoded CA certificate to use for TLS verification. Required unless state is cronly. | |
| detailLevel str | The detail level to keep in the transaction log for the transaction resulting from this request. | |
| disableBatching bool | If true, prevents the transaction resulting from this request from being bundled with others. | |
| hash str | Resource content will be returned as it was at the time of this git hash | |
| name str required | Name of the AggregateRoute. Required when state is query or absent. | |
| namespace str required | The namespace to use when querying or removing the resource. Required when state is query or absent. | |
| resource dict required | The AggregateRoute resource definition in YAML format as seen in the EDA UI or https://crd.eda.dev. Required when state is present or cronly. | |
| state str required | Choices: absent, query, present, cronly | State of the requested resource object. |
| tlsSkipVerify bool required | A flag to control the TLS verification of the session. Required unless state is cronly. |
Authors#
- Roman Dodin (@hellt)